00 — Overview

What the MSP430G2553 does

The MSP430G2x53 is an ultra-low-power mixed signal microcontroller featuring a 16-bit RISC architecture, 10-bit 200-ksps analog-to-digital converter, and up to 24 capacitive-touch enabled I/O pins. It operates across a supply voltage range of 1.8V to 3.6V with active mode current as low as 230 µA at 1 MHz. The family includes variants with 256 KB or 512 KB flash memory and 16 or 32 KB RAM, available in 20, 28, and 32-pin packages. These devices are typically used in low-cost sensor systems that capture analog signals, convert them to digital values, and process the data for display or transmission to a host system.
